The OCZ Vertex 460 replaces the Vertex 450. The main difference between the two is a change from Intel/Micron (IMFT) 20nm MLC NAND to Toshiba 19nm MLC NAND, a fitting move considering that Toshiba acquired OCZ shortly before the Vertex 460's release. Comparing the Vertex 460 and 450 shows that the two drives are broadly on a par in terms of performance. In terms of pricing the Vertex 460 is priced reasonably considering its age, I expect prices will drop rapidly as retailers build stocks of the relatively new drive. At current prices the 240GB Vertex 460 represents above average value for money but struggles to compete with its slightly more expensive sibling, the Vector 150. Comparing the 460 and 150 shows that Vector 150 leads in terms of effective speed by 10% but only costs 5% more than the 460. [Mar '14 SSDrivePro]

The 240GB OCZ ARC has a solid performance profile with particularly strong 4K speeds. The ARC is positioned below both OCZ's enthusiast Vector 150 and the mainstream Vertex 460 but based on hardware specs there is very little separating the drives (newer NAND on the ARC). Comparing the Vertex 460 and ARC shows that the ARC lags particularly in terms of sequential write speed but the overall difference in effective speed is marginal. The broad performance equivalence coupled with the fact that the Vertex 460 is available at the same price point makes the 240GB ARC somewhat redundant for the time being. Given that the ARC is relatively new, prices are likely to drop significantly over the coming months at which point the ARC may make more sense. [Sep '14 SSDrivePro]
